Kerewan crowned Kombo North champions![]() Wednesday, July 18, 2012 Kombo Kerewan United were over the weekend crowned champions of this year’s Kombo North District football championship following a 2-0 defeat of Sukuta in a final played at the Kerewan football field. Musa Sanyang opened the scorings for Kerewan United in the first half following a swift break from a counter attack after only four minutes into the game. Goalkeeper Ensa Jarju started the move by sending a long ball to the far right which was met by captain Samba Gibba whose one time cross was slotted in by Sanyang. Sukuta dominated proceedings from that point but missed several opportunities to equalise and were severely punished once again on the break. Musa Sanyang agin turned out to be the hero scoring his second goal and winner on the half hour mark after Sukuta failed to clear their area when the ball hit a cross bar. During the second half Sukuta tried all they could but the closest they came to grabbing a goal was in the 78th minute when substitute Abdoulie Cham was thwarted by the Kerewan defence as they tried to pull the trigger. As winners, Kerewan went home with a giant trophy and a cash prize of D6000 while Sukuta pocketed D4000. Sulayman Bojang was awarded best player of the tournament while certificates were also awarded to the referees. Author: Modou Lamin Sanneh | Media Actions See Also |
